Providers & Buyers: We have added two new algorithms, X15 and NIST5 (talkcoin).

Providers: A straight-forward configuration would be the same as X11/X13, you should just use:

Code:
"algorithm" : "bitblock",

for X15

and

Code:
"algorithm" : "talkcoin-mod",

for NIST5.

btw: make sure you have the latest sgminer_v5 from https://www.nicehash.com/software/#sgminer

Of course, you should tune your configuration for optimal performance. Also, if you're using multi-algo (https://www.nicehash.com/multialgo/) make sure you add x15 and nist5 to your configuration.

I was getting much better speed from my 260x than 780kh/s on X11/X13.  

Try these settings, should work with the new algos as well:

gpu-engine: 1150
gpu-memclock: 1500
xintensity:  120
worksize: 64
hamsi-expand-big: 1

darkcoin-mod for X11 should yield 1050kh/s
marucoin-mod for X13 should yield 950kh/s

ps.  i set thread-concurrency to 8000 for this GPU for scrypt/-n, it is also set the same for x11/15 but shouldnt matter.  for scrypt and scrypt-n, gpu-engine should be 750 for the 260x.
